Resort’s development application poised for next steps in Paradise Valley

By Melisssa Rosequist | Paradise Valley Independent

Paradise Valley Town Council took its second look at a statement of direction for Andaz Scottsdale Resort and Bungalows’ application to build 10 guest units on the resort’s remaining vacant land.

A statement of direction sets up parameters for what the town’s Planning Commission should focus on during its deep-dive application evaluation.

The Town Council reviewed the draft statement of direction initially on Sept. 8, followed by a second look on Sept. 22. The Council is expected to vote on the statement of direction on Oct. 13 to formally adopt the document before it moves forward to the Planning Commission.
